What factors affect peltier cell power generation?

Peltier cell power generation depends on different parameters: temperature gap across the cell, encapsulating layer thickness and operating temperature. What is the composition of Peltier generation system?

The composition of Peltier generation system consists of a heat source to obtain a temperature gradient between the two sides of cells. A closed system is used to maintain the temperature on the hot side, while on the cold side there is a heat dissipater to dissipate the heat to the environment.
